An exhibition celebrating the Diamond Jubilee by looking at the ways that Ely has celebrated Royal Occasions in the past.
With photographs and souvenirs from Coronations and Jubilees from Victoria to Elizabeth, come see how Ely has celebrated all things regal. Lavish parties, commemoration medals and newspaper accounts combine to give a glimpse of how Ely has joined the nation in fondly honouring our royal family.
